GS1 Mobile Com vision

• 3 billion mobile phones: the new channel of commerce and of the consumer-centric chain.

• Lack of standards does not enable retailers and brands to offer mobile commerce services in a global, simple and cost efficient way.

• GS1 will enable it to happen in collaboration with the mobile industry.

Extended Packaging Overview

Key concept: consumers access additional informationabout products through their mobile phone

GS1 France Code On Line Demonstrator

Step 1 (before shopping) :

The consumer downloads GS1 CodeOnLine application and defines the information he is interested in.

Step 2a (in the shop) :

The consumer opens GS1 CodeOnLine application and takes a picture of the product that he may buy.

Step 2b (in the shop) :

A few seconds later, he receives the required information about the product on his mobile phone from a GDSN catalogue.
